Subject: DR drill — cron drift follow-up

Team, during the Bramblewick failover drill we confirmed the scheduler drift came from a stale timezone snapshot, not the cron daemon itself. Patch is in review; please check the offset math carefully. To restore the drill-environment scheduler vault and replay the jobs, use the recovery passphrase below.

unlock words, kawig-bawef: belax-sorir-druax-ulaiel-wenael-belael

// REINDEX_BATCH_CAP limits docs per shard pass in the Tallowfield
// nightly search reindex. Raising it starves the ingest queue;
// lowering it overruns the maintenance window. 5000 is the tested
// sweet spot. Change only with a soak run. Verified against the
// build noted below.

session token of bawif-hahog = htk6_ac5981

Subject: Quickstore 4.2 — bloom filter now fronts the KV layer

Plugin authors: starting with this release, Quickstore places a bloom filter ahead of the key-value store. Negative lookups return faster; false positives fall through safely. No API changes are required on your side. Verify your plugin against the staging build referenced below.

session token of fahif-tadup = htk3_9c7

- [ ] **Step 7: Breaker override escrow.** After sealing the signing keys for the Tallgrove upstream API circuit breaker, confirm the support team can force the breaker open during a full outage. The override bundle lives in the sealed escrow drawer and is useless without its unlock phrase. Two ceremony witnesses must initial this step before proceeding. The escrow bundle is decrypted with the recovery passphrase that follows.

vault phrase of kahip-kahop = holath-quenmir